Life can feel like a whirlwind—between work, family, responsibilities, and everything in between, it’s easy to feel stretched thin. But balance doesn’t mean doing it all—it means finding alignment with what matters most. In this episode, I share simple strategies to maintain balance when life feels overwhelming.
Whether you’re juggling a demanding career, family commitments, or your own personal goals, this conversation will give you permission to let go of perfection, embrace simplicity, and create space for joy even in the busiest seasons of life.
